简历上,我写精通 JUC 的底气

真的假的,你简历上敢写精通 JUC ?

是真学到精通了,还是说只学到了个皮毛就写精通,从而争取一个面试机会。

我相信,当很多人看到文章标题的第一反应也会如上面的一样,质疑、好奇。这很正常,如果是我看到这种文章标题,我也会和大家一样,有疑惑且想探明这个博主是否真的如他所说真精通了 JUC。

那,各位看官就请耐心的往下看。

时间回到几个月前,我上着班,悠闲的在群里摸鱼时,就看到群里有人在聊 Java 并发这块的内容,什么并发安全、并发可见性,有序性,volatile 等等。我看的是津津有味,一会觉得这个群友说的对,一会又觉得另一个群友理解的也并无道理,反之就是没有什么主观性,听风就是雨,觉得谁说的都有道理。

提一下,这可不是我水平差啊!

我是真觉得他们说的有道理,平时肯定没少背着我偷偷的卷,真气人。

在这里插入图片描述

既然这样,那我也要卷死你们,我要开始再学一遍 JUC 了,因为他们讨论的东西都离不开 Java 的并发编程,而聊并发编程肯定也离不开 JUC 包,所以,有方向了,那就开卷。

在接下来的日子里,我把下班后的所有时间都用在了学习并发编程这块上。从我开始整理相关的内容到现在用了三个多月(还没整理完,进度:90%),可能有人会说为啥这么久?其实我也不想这么的,因为我没想到一入并发真的是深似海

其实,我要是按照平时学习技术的进度来深入 JUC 并发这块的内容是不用学习这么久的。但是我想着,既然都学了这么深,那何不再深入点,把学到的东西用详细的文档写出来,用通俗易懂的话术直播讲解分享出来呢!

毕竟,我也是一个坚持写博客好几年的码农,写文档这块是不在话下的。同样也是一位入行 B 站有一段时间的萌新 UP,直播讲解技术内容也是能咬牙坚持,所以这三个月内就有了下面的这些产出。

提交了三个月的代码

在这里插入图片描述

这些代码主要是记录了在学习 JUC 并发过程中的一些场景案例和手写源码系列。

写了十二万字左右的并发内容文档

在这里插入图片描述

这 12W+ 字的文档是重点了,我将每个知识点的介绍、用法及源码都写在这个文档上了,其中包括源码逐行解释,图解分析等,立志做到通俗易懂。

直播三十余场技术分享课

在这里插入图片描述

这些视频分享全部都是我直播时所录屏的,因为我白天上班,晚上只能 22 点之后才有时间直播。而很多人可能这个点就不太想坐在电脑前内卷观看我直播了(当然我还是希望你直播观看,因为这样能互动),所以就有了这个录播,方便大家空余时间观看提升自己。

当然,这些还不是我整理的所有内容,因为我在学习并发这块的内容时,时常要去找一些资料啊,书籍啊来进行佐证。特别是前期为了给大家呈现出一个清晰,易懂的并发理论模型,我可是费了老鼻子劲了。一边看 intel 的操作手册,一边看外网的内存模型资料,一边看相关的视频介绍等,然后通过我的吸收和理解,写下自己的技术笔记和直播时讲解的话术。

至于为啥要做的这么详细,前面我说是为了自己巩固 Java 并发相关的内容,但这只是其一。其二则是,我发现市面上真的没有一套完整 + 免费的 Java 并发内容讲解视频,真没有,是真没有,如果有,欢迎大家来打脸

我对完整内容的定义

必须给你们先灌输一套内存模型,探究并发安全问题的本质,才好继续往下学习

必须给你们把 volatile + synchronized 的 C++ 源码实现讲清楚

必须给你们把 CAS 从汇编代码层面讲清楚

必须给你们把 unsafe + LockSupper 工具类给你们讲清楚

必须给你们把原子引用包下的所有类讲清楚

必须给你们把 AQS 原理 + 源码讲清楚

必须给你们把 Lock 相关内容讲清楚,包括读写锁

必须给你们把 ThreadLocal 讲清楚

必须给你们把 CopyOnWrite + ConcurrentHashMap 从原理到源码讲清楚

必须给你们把阻塞队列讲清楚,这里的阻塞队列我分析了常见的和不常见的一共八种,都一套讲完

必须给你们把线程池原理讲清楚

等等

我对免费的定义

必须是没有任何付费的机制就能看到的视频,而我 B 站上的视频,就是免费不需要付费观看

那么,到此,如果上面的内容都已经掌握的话,你们觉得在简历上能否写:精通 JUC 呢!

如果是我,我就这么干,为啥?

请,清楚你的定位是找到一份工作,而找工作的第一步是要向他人展示你自己获得一个面试机会,而简历就是向他人展示你自己的凭证。如果在两份简历中,我看到一份写着熟悉 JUC 或者掌握 JUC 和一份写着精通 JUC,那我相信一定是精通的更让人满意,获得面试机会的概率更大。

注意,我这里是只针对精通 JUC 这一块来说,而不是整篇简历对比,如果我不说清楚,我怕有人会和我抬杠!

我把我的这个系列视频定义为:【 Java 并发全解】,立志做到市面上唯一一份完整且免费的并发学习视频。

不过,我的【 Java 并发全解】相关的内容还没有正式完结,所以革命尚未成功,我还需努力。但不影响大家给我的系类视频点赞 + 关注 + 转发,小小的支持是给我最大的认可与前进的动力。

视频地址:

https://www.bilibili.com/video/BV15j411A78S/

最后,感谢各位看官看到这里,如果有不同的看法,欢迎评论区留言指正。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/21308.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

看过近百份简历后,才悟到简历应该怎么写【以申请硕博为例】

1. 跨越卓越之路:硕博申请简历全攻略 每个人都渴望获得更高层次的教育,攀登事业的顶峰。硕士和博士申请是通往顶尖教育的重要途径。为了提高成功率,我们需要准备一份出色的简历。在本科毕业之际,我们曾修过一门课程——就业指导课…

博士申请 | 新加坡国立大学Robby T. Tan教授招收CV方向全奖博士/博后/访问学生

合适的工作难找?最新的招聘信息也不知道? AI 求职为大家精选人工智能领域最新鲜的招聘信息,助你先人一步投递,快人一步入职! 新加坡国立大学 新加坡国立大学(National University of Singapore)&#xff0c…

博后招募 | 哈佛大学医学院招募医学信息学和NLP方向博士后

合适的工作难找?最新的招聘信息也不知道? AI 求职为大家精选人工智能领域最新鲜的招聘信息,助你先人一步投递,快人一步入职! 哈佛大学 哈佛医学院和BWH医院的Division of Pharmacoepidemiology and Pharmacoeconomics是…

博士申请 | 香港中文大学(深圳)徐扬生院士团队招收人工智能全奖博士生

合适的工作难找?最新的招聘信息也不知道? AI 求职为大家精选人工智能领域最新鲜的招聘信息,助你先人一步投递,快人一步入职! 香港中文大学(深圳) 香港中文大学 (深圳) 是一所经国家教育部批准&a…

博士申请 | 香港科技大学郭毅可教招收创造性人工智能方向博士/博后/RA

合适的工作难找?最新的招聘信息也不知道? AI 求职为大家精选人工智能领域最新鲜的招聘信息,助你先人一步投递,快人一步入职! 香港科技大学 香港科技大学 (The Hong Kong University of Science and Technology)&#x…

奥特曼看了都说好:GPT2-chinese 问题补丁

1. temperature参数相当于给softmax降降温,让各个词概率差距加大(跟刚才的随机 sample 相比,增加了高概率词的可能性,降低了低概率词的可能性)公式如下: top_p:已知生成各个词的总概率是1&…

如何使用GPT2中文闲聊对话系统,机器人对话,自动对话!

目录 目录结构: 运行环境: 首次运行: 如何训练自己的模型: 数据预处理: 训练模型: 如何确定这个--val_num数值: ​编辑​编辑最后说明: 打算做一个微博自动评论的一个模型&a…

C++ 奥特曼打怪兽之类的应用(系列3)

题目描述 在前面实验的基础上,根据题目要求进行修改,实现打斗过程。 怪兽分为四种类型(定义四个类): 普通型怪兽(NMonster):攻击力是等级2倍,生命是10倍,金钱经验是10倍 攻击型怪兽&…

用Python做一个奥特曼打怪兽的小游戏

话不多说,往下看吧! 引入需要的模块 from sprites import * from pygame import mixer设置页面格式(宽高等等) width,height 800,600 screen Screen() screen.setup(width,height) screen.bgcolor(black) screen.title(奥特曼…

C++ 奥特曼打怪兽之类的实现(系列2)

题目描述 在实验《类定义》的基础,改进并实现游戏中的两个类:奥特曼类和怪兽类。使得两个类更加接近实际要求。 奥特曼说明如下: 为每个属性设置get方法,注意奥特曼所有属性都需要 初始化(利用构造函数完成初始化),参…

用C语言画一个Q版奥特曼

有一天原本平静的村庄突然受到不明寄生生命体的袭击!“快逃!”“可是……” 快找出怪兽玛格尼亚的弱点,欢迎收看迪迦奥特曼的下集大雾来了。 今天分享一个用C语言画Q版奥特曼的源码~ 用到的是easyx图形库绘图功能,所以需要下载安…

2023-热门ChatGPT解析及使用方法

什么是Chat GPT?我们能用它来干什么? Chat GPT是一款基于人工智能技术的自然语言处理模型,由OpenAI团队开发。它能够通过机器学习技术从海量文本数据中学习语言知识,实现自然语言生成、对话生成和语言理解等功能,使得…

何让ChatGPT自动生成内容,作为客户服务工作人员的回答话术?

该场景对应的关键词库(13个): 产品知识、使用方法、售后服务、售后维修、支付方式、支付流程、产品购买、产品配送、客户投诉、客户建议、政策法规、使用注意事项、客服身份 提问模板: 1、客服团队一般需要回答几个方面的问题&…

2023爱分析 · 元宇宙厂商全景报告 | 爱分析报告

报告编委 黄勇 爱分析合伙人&首席分析师 文鸿伟 爱分析高级分析师 目录 1. 研究范围定义 2. 市场洞察 3. 厂商全景地图 4. 市场分析与厂商评估 5. 入选厂商列表 1. 研究范围定义 研究范围 2021年3月,十四五规划中首次提及元宇宙,指…

字节跳动 CEO 梁汝波发内部信:头条、西瓜、搜索等业务并入抖音

2021 年 11 月 2 日,字节跳动 CEO 梁汝波发布一则内部信,重磅宣布根据业务需要进行的组织结构优化和升级举措,以抖音、教育、飞书、火山引擎、朝夕光年、TikTok 六大业务板块为依托,遵循“紧密配合的业务和团队合并为业务板块&…

【报告分享】ChatGPT:AI模型框架研究.pdf(附下载链接)

省时查报告-专业、及时、全面的行研报告库 省时查方案-专业、及时、全面的营销策划方案库 【免费下载】2023年2月份热门报告合集 【限时免费】ChatGPT4体验,无需翻墙直接用 ChatGPT团队背景研究报告 ChatGPT的发展历程、原理、技术架构及未来方向 ChatGPT使用总结&a…

ChatGPT 用redis实现分布式锁

背景 打算基于springboot、RedisTemplate,由ChatGPT来实现分布式锁,记录全过程。 基础介绍 基于RedisTemplate实现分布式锁 基于springboot及RedisTemplate实现分布式锁 在Spring Boot中,我们可以通过RedisTemplate来使用Redis的分布式锁机…

gpt人工智能写论文怎么样-chatGTP如何写论文

用gpt写论文怎么样 使用 GPT 写论文具体的操作方法因人而异,但可以提供一些建议: 充分理解论文的题目、主题和结构,并确定论文所需的内容和方向。 针对论文的不同部分,使用 GPT 模型进行自动化生成或补充,例如摘要、…

GPT-4 还没玩透,GPT-5已遭众人围剿

GPT-4 火爆全球,引发了人工智能大浪潮。OpenAI、微软、谷歌、百度都在不断释放王炸,所有人都相信,AI 的就是未来的生产力。 网友们在体验了性能炸裂的GPT-4之后,显然已经迫不及待地等着GPT-5的到来了。据报道 GPT-5 将于今年冬天…

人工智能开源系统,独立版本开发,国内服务器部署

Chatgpt是最近爆火的一个话题,可以通过人工智能,编辑生成自己想要的文案或者文章,但是由于防火墙的限制,国内无法直接访问,针对此问题我们开发出一套此功能的系统,。 源码下载:http://c.nxw.so/…